What to Think About Before Spending on A Fence
It's pretty hard to take your fence back after you have bought it and it's in the ground, right? Keep in mind it's not just the fence, and it's also the installation contractor - so that's even more to be concerned about. Just about all people cannot quickly or easily visualize how a particular fence in a picture will truly appear until it's installed on your property. That's why you have to read information such as what is in this article, and you'll be smarter for it.
All people have the same general reasons for wanting to put up a fence, but then it can change if you want to get fancy about it, or not. So regardless of the ultimate reason for your fence, you should match it along with ancillary desires such as something ornamental. Usually there are just wood and metal fences, but between those two categories you'll have a ton to choose from. Either metal based fences and wood are fine more or less, and what matters to you most is what you should use as a guideline. Some people just think that wood has a better look and feel to it and so they use that as their personal criteria.
If you want to do more with your fence, or have it serve more than one purpose, then the ornamental type of fencing is in order. You should at least shop for it and go and check it out first hand, also, what you see in pictures on the web as compared to in-person is just different. What will make or break your deal are usually the materials because they are not all made to the same standards. If you appreciate the more beautiful aspects of things, then by all means see all the styles for them.
One reason why so many want a fence is just because so they let the pet dog out and be kept in the garden. If this is the case, you can have a boundary fence or a rail fence, but you'll need to install something at the base such as chicken wire to keep the pet in the garden. The important thing here is that the dog won't get out or jump the fence plus you want it to be safe for your pet. Choosing from a catalog is possible when you go to a qualified contractor who installs fences.
You know a little more about what's needed before you buy a fence. And just about all people have no clue about these things but that's not their fault because it's not every day kind of information. So it's a good idea to do some basic research and be sure to ask a lot of questions.
